Among the most crucial innovations utilized in electrical insulation diagnostics is the tan delta kit. Insulation systems are fundamental to the safe and trustworthy procedure of transformers, wires, generators, bushings, and turning machines. With time, insulation materials degrade because of thermal stress, wetness access, contamination, electrical aging, and ecological direct exposure. A tan delta package aids designers evaluate insulation problem by gauging dielectric losses and insulation dissipation elements.
Tan delta screening plays a crucial role in anticipating maintenance techniques because it enables maintenance groups to identify insulation destruction long in the past devastating failures happen. Utilities and industrial drivers progressively rely upon advanced tan delta set systems to improve possession administration, maximize maintenance organizing, and reduce unanticipated tools failures. Security systems are an additional crucial component of modern power networks. Electric relays are accountable for finding unusual operating problems and separating mistakes to prevent tools damages and make sure grid security. The accuracy and reaction time of protective relays directly influence the safety and security and dependability of substations, transmission lines, and industrial power systems. A relay test set is consequently an necessary device for confirming relay efficiency and making certain proper security coordination.
Modern relay screening needs advanced capacities as a result of the boosting fostering of digital substations, intelligent electronic gadgets, and microprocessor-based security systems. Designers should verify timing accuracy, existing injection performance, interaction methods, and mistake simulation responses under various operating conditions. Existing transformers and possible transformers are equally important for metering, security, and dimension systems. Errors in CT and PT efficiency can endanger relay operation, metering precision, and fault evaluation abilities. A CT PT analyser enables designers to examine transformer proportion accuracy, excitation features, polarity, problem performance, winding resistance, and insulation problem. Accurate testing aids utilities preserve conformity with security criteria and operational safety and security requirements.
As power systems end up being increasingly advanced, the function of a CT PT analyser expands past routine commissioning. Utilities currently make use of innovative diagnostic analysis to keep track of aging transformer problems, recognize core issues, and boost substation dependability. Battery systems also play a crucial function in electrical facilities. Substations, power plants, telecommunications networks, information centers, renewable energy facilities, and industrial control systems all depend on back-up battery systems to preserve functional connection during power disruptions. Battery failings can compromise security systems, communication networks, emergency situation lighting, and critical automation framework. Consequently, normal battery screening has actually become a important maintenance concern.
A battery tons bank is widely made use of to examine battery efficiency under controlled operating problems. By using a substitute tons, engineers can assess battery ability, voltage security, discharge performance, and functional wellness. Correct battery screening helps organizations determine weak cells, aging batteries, and potential reliability risks before failures occur throughout critical occasions.

Switchgear upkeep is an additional crucial location within high-voltage power systems. Vacuum circuit breakers are extensively used because of their dependability, portable design, and reduced upkeep needs. However, vacuum cleaner interrupters can still experience insulation degeneration, vacuum loss, call wear, or interior problems in time. A vacuum bottle test set allows designers to assess vacuum cleaner integrity and interrupter efficiency without taking apart the tools.
Accurate bottle testing aids energies prevent circuit breaker failures, boost functional safety and security, and prolong tools life expectancy. As substations become significantly automated and power needs continue increasing, dependable switchgear performance stays essential for keeping grid stability and minimizing failure dangers. Partial discharge activity is among the earliest indications of insulation wear and tear within high-voltage equipment. Partial discharges happen when localized electrical malfunction establishes within insulation systems because of gaps, contamination, problems, or maturing products. If left undetected, partial discharge activity can slowly damage insulation and ultimately cause tragic equipment failing.
A partial discharge tester is consequently one of the most crucial analysis devices utilized in predictive maintenance and condition monitoring programs. Engineers make use of partial discharge testing to examine transformers, wires, generators, switchgear, motors, GIS systems, and rotating machines. Spotting partial discharge activity at an beginning permits maintenance teams to address insulation issues prior to failings effect system dependability.

Circuit breakers are amongst one of the most essential protection tools in electrical networks. Their ability to disrupt mistake currents safely and quickly is essential for securing devices and maintaining operational stability. Mechanical wear, contact erosion, timing mistakes, and operational failures can significantly affect breaker efficiency with time. A breaker analyser aids engineers review breaker timing, movement features, call resistance, coil operation, and synchronization performance.
Modern substations require accurate circuit breaker diagnostics since even tiny inconsistencies in breaker operation can jeopardize defense control and fault-clearing performance. Utilities progressively count on innovative circuit breaker analyser systems to boost upkeep preparation, prolong devices life, and make certain compliance with operational standards.
